    Here is a table outlining domestic flights that leave from SYD T1 and MEL T2 respectively, mainly for the purposes of F lounge opportunities.

    Code:
    Flight   Orig   Dest   Connect   Dep   Arr   A/C Freq    C/In Menus
    JQ3      MEL    SYD    -HNL      1310  1435  332 1...... 1010 B! A
    JQ30     MEL    SYD    BKK-      1140  1305  332 ..3.5.. 0840 B  A!
    QF81     MEL    ADL    -SIN      1155  1245  333 .2.4... 0855 B  A!
    JQ19     SYD    OOL    -KIX      0850  0915  332 1.345.7 0550 B  
    JQ29     SYD    MEL    -BKK      1100  1230  332 .2..... 0800 B
    JQ35     SYD    MEL    -DPS      1515  1645  332 .2...6. 1215    A
    QF81     SYD    ADL    -SIN      1110  1245  333 .....6. 0810 B
    
    Notes/key:
    • Connect: a - before the location means that this flight continues to this location from the Dest on the same flight number. A - after the location means that this flight originated from the given location and arrived at the Orig on the given flight number.
    • Freq: 1 = Monday
    • C/In is the time check-in opens, figuring on a standard policy of 3 hours before departure.
    • Menus: describes what menus are available to you if you choose this flight to access the F Lounge. B = breakfast menu (pre-11am); A = all day menu (post-11am). A ! indicates that the menu is available but for a limited time (e.g. due to arrival or departure time from the lounge).
    • Table uses data from current timetables (as of the time of this post), however:
      • All Japan bound flights via CNS have been ignored (services end Dec 2008).
      • SYD-BNE-MNL is ignored (service becomes SYD-MNL direct starting Jan 2009).
      • SYD-OOL-KIX frequency is based on that effective 18/12/2008.

    QF81 and QF82 are odd.

    QF81 does SYD-SIN once a week (Sat), but QF82 does SIN-SYD twice (Sat and Tue)

    QF81 does MEL-SIN twice a week (Tue and Thu), but QF82 only returns to MEL once (Thu)
